Merge lp://staging/~jamestait/hedera/start-adding-tests into lp://staging/hedera
Status: | Needs review |
---|---|
Proposed branch: | lp://staging/~jamestait/hedera/start-adding-tests |
Merge into: | lp://staging/hedera |
Diff against target: |
114 lines (+81/-5) 4 files modified
README (+11/-4) content/sync.js (+5/-1) mozmill/tests/test_test.js (+15/-0) run_tests.py (+50/-0) |
To merge this branch: | bzr merge lp://staging/~jamestait/hedera/start-adding-tests |
Related bugs: |
Reviewer | Review Type | Date Requested | Status |
---|---|---|---|
Hedera Hackers | Pending | ||
Review via email:
|
Description of the change
Start adding the framework for Mozmill tests, in preparation for some heavy refactoring.
Unmerged revisions
- 66. By James Tait
-
Add an option to keep the database after the tests have run.
- 65. By James Tait
-
Add option parsing, so we can specify the test database to use.
- 64. By James Tait
-
Improved the script to run tests, so that it now deleted the test database when it finishes. Updated the README accordingly.
- 63. By James Tait
-
Clean up the NOINIT stuff, which we don't yet use; make sure we run a separate Thunderbird process; make tests use a dedicated CouchDB database.
- 62. By James Tait
-
Started adding the infrastructure to be able to run tests, along with a very simple test file with one passing and one failing test. Updated the README with details, as long as updating the instructions for debugging.